About the Hotel

4 St. George Street #101, St. Augustine, Florida, United States of America, 32084

St George Inn - Saint Augustine, a 4-star boutique hotel in Historic District, features two magnificent courtyards overlooking Castillo de San Marcos and City Gate, positioned at the end of pedestrian-only St George Street.

Panoramic Room Views

All rooms at St George Inn - Saint Augustine offer eye-catching views of the courtyard, Castillo de San Marco, City Gate, Oldest Wooden Schoolhouse, or Matanzas Inlet, with many featuring balconies and rocking chairs.

Dining and Wine

Each morning begins with a European-style breakfast serving croissants, bagels, muffins, and Florida oranges in the dining room, complemented by Bin 39 wine bar offering 65 top-rated wines.

Meeting and Events

The property features a conference room for 10 guests and a 600-square-foot patio accommodating up to 50 people, plus private wine tasting events with a Wine Ambassador.

Room Amenities

All accommodations include wireless internet, private baths, in-room refrigerators, coffee makers, and antique brass ceiling fans.

Historic Location Access

Located in St Augustine's Historic District, the hotel provides direct access to Spanish-Colonial landmarks including the 1600s Castillo de San Marcos and González-Alvarez House.
